    Hi,

    i am unable to isntall wsus. I get error:

    The update could not be found. Either the update is not applicable to this computer or the update no longer exists. Verify that the update still exists and is applicable to this computer from your WSUS server or Windows Update.

    MS sql std 2005 with sp3 is installed on the server,

    thanks
    aurimas

    Hi aurimas,

    Could you please provide the OS version of your WSUS server?

    If you want to add the WSUS role via Server Manager On Windows Server 2008, When you try to add the add role from servermanager its try to download the WSUS SP1 to install

    Please check the below registry key make sure its set the MU site for downloading the patches

    HKLM\Software\Policies\Microsoft\Windows\WindowsUpdate

    Or Download the WSUS SP1 manually from the using the KB
    http://support.microsoft.com/kb/948014/en-us -
    “Description of the Windows Server Update Services 3.0 Service Pack 1 package”

    Hope this helps.
